在Web開發中,使用Django和Vue.js架構是一種越來越受歡迎的選擇。Django是一個高度模塊化的Web框架,提供完整的MVC框架和許多內置功能。而Vue.js則是一個靈活的JavaScript框架,可以用于構建前端應用程序。
在Django中使用Vue.js時,我們可以使用Vue組件來簡化代碼。組件是Vue.js中的一種構建塊,可以封裝重復使用的代碼并提供更好的代碼組織。下面是一個簡單的Vue組件示例:
Vue.component('my-component', { template: '<div><p>This is my component.</p></div>' });
在上面的代碼中,我們定義了一個名為“my-component”的Vue組件,該組件具有一個模板。該模板被定義為一個字符串,其中包含HTML代碼。使用組件時,我們可以像下面這樣引用它:
<my-component></my-component>
在Django中,可以使用Vue.js組件來生成前端用戶界面。組件可以在Vue.js應用程序中定義,并與Django視圖函數和模板一起合并。這樣,就可以通過簡單的組件調用來添加前端組件,并將數據傳遞給組件,使其在用戶界面上呈現。
綜上所述,Vue組件是Web開發中的重要構建塊,可以使用它們來簡化代碼并改善代碼組織。在Django中使用Vue.js組件時,可以輕松生成前端用戶界面,并通過組件調用將數據傳遞給組件,以在用戶界面上呈現。